St. Peter Roman Catholic School has a dress code to which all students must adhere.

 

GIRLS in the Elementary and Middle School:

1. No makeup
2. No bright or distracting nail polish (light shades are acceptable)
3. No dangling/hoop earrings
4. No hairstyles or accessories that may be distracting to others
5. No tattoos
6. Only one earring per ear

BOYS in the Elementary and Middle School:

1. No earrings
2. No pony tails, Mohawks or other distracting styles
3. No tattoos

 **Please note that jewelry for all students is limited to a simple, plain necklace, watch or bracelet and simple ring. There is to be no chain necklaces, multiple necklaces, chunky rings.

 If in doubt, don’t wear it. Take pride in your school uniform!

 Uniforms for Girls in All Grades:

  • Length of uniform skirt must touch floor when kneeling on ground

  • All shirts must be tucked in, not worn on top of pants or skirts

  • Dark brown or black shoes and socks are required

  • Plain white or navy socks or tights (no patterns)

  • NO sneakers, wheelie-sneakers, sandals, clogs or platform, open-toed or high-heeled shoes (More than 1 inch) are allowed

These rules will be enforced this year.  Any student with the incorrect uniform will be calling home to their parents.

Uniforms for Boys in All Grades:

  • Dark brown or black shoes and socks are required

  • A belt is required

  • All shirts must be tucked in, not worn on top of pants

  • Socks can be navy blue, black or white (no patterns)

  • NO running shoes, sneakers, sandals or clogs, open toed shoes or ‘wheelie’ sneakers are allowed

These rules will be enforced this year.  Any student with the incorrect uniform will be calling home to their parents.

Warm Weather Uniform for All Students:

From the first day of school until October 15th and from May 1st until the last day of school, boys and girls are permitted to wear navy dress shorts. All shorts must be knee length.  All other uniform requirements remain in effect.

 

Boys and Girls Physical Education Uniform: 

Grades Pre- K to 5:

Students must wear light gray official St. Peter’s T-Shirt, Sweatshirt, sweatpants and sneakers to participate in gym class. If they are not in uniform they will be marked ‘unprepared’ and not be allowed to participate. 

Grades 6 to 8:

The middle school students are allowed to wear shorts, sweatpants and windpants with t-shirts or sweatshirts to gym class.  Boys can wear basketball shorts, sweatpants and windpants with a t-shirt or sweatshirt.  Girls can wear long shorts, sweatpants, and wind pants with a t-shirt or sweatshirt.  If your not in the above uniform code you will be marked as unprepared for class and not be allowed to participate. 

**Missing several classes of gym due to violation of dress code will affect your grade.
